    Child among 24 Palestinians wounded by Israeli army raid in Ramallah | Occupied West Bank News

    Israeli snipers positioned themselves on rooftops as troops stormed Ramallah and el-Bireh.

    The Israeli army has launched a raid on Ramallah and el-Bireh in the occupied West Bank, with the Palestine Red Crescent Society (PRCS) reporting that at least 24 Palestinians have been wounded in the attacks.

    The wounded included a 12-year-old child, shot in the back near a vegetable market, the Wafa news agency, citing medical teams, reported on Tuesday.

    Israel raid wounds 14 in West Bank’s Ramallah: Red Crescent

    The Israeli army raided the West Bank city of Ramallah on Tuesday, leaving 14 people wounded as troops fanned out across the city centre, the Palestinian Red Crescent said.

    Tensions have remained high in the occupied West Bank since Hamas’s October 2023 attack on Israel which sparked the Gaza war, with repeated raids by the Israeli army on Palestinian population centres, particularly in the north.

    Living in ‘sin’? Ronaldo, Rodriguez highlight Saudi double standard

    When Cristiano Ronaldo and Georgina Rodriguez announced their engagement this month, two things stood out: the outsized diamond ring, and their unmarried cohabitation in conservative Saudi Arabia.

    The celebrity couple and their blended brood of five children have been living in the birthplace of Islam for more than two years, untroubled by laws against extra-marital relationships.

    China ‘shocked’ over Israeli killing of journalists in Gaza – Middle East Monitor

    China on Tuesday expressed “shock” over the killing of journalists by Israel in Gaza, urging an end to the war in the besieged Palestinian enclave, Anadolu reports.

    “We are shocked by the tragic death of medical workers and journalists yet again in the Gaza conflict. We condemn the attack and mourn for the victims and express sympathies for the families of the victims,” Foreign Ministry spokesman Guo Jiakun told reporters in Beijing.

    Are We Getting Closer To A Broader Cure For HIV?

    Since the landmark stem cell transplantation which saw Timothy Ray Brown become the first person to be cured of HIV in 2007, ten people around the world have been reported either cured or in long-term remission from the virus through similar procedures.

    Who is Rio Ngumoha, Liverpool’s youngest ever goalscorer? | Football News

    Teenager is being touted as the next great young English forward after scoring against Newcastle in the Premier League.

    Rio Ngumoha made history on Monday by becoming the youngest goal scorer for the famous England side Liverpool.

    The winger came on as a substitute for the defending Premier League champions and scored the winning goal to secure the 3-2 win against Newcastle United at St James’ Park.

    Ngumoha is only the fourth 16-year-old to score a Premier League goal.
